Crater, Acadia, Glacier: America's most beautiful national parks, based on 2023 reviews

Utah has four while Colorado, Arizona and Washington each have two on the top 25 list, compiled by Travel Lens based on Google reviews in 2023. Parks missing from the list include the Grand Canyon.

With 63 National Parks across the United States to choose from, a new analysis of reviews by Travel Lens has revealed its top 25 most beautiful national parks in the country.

The online travel publication analyzed thousands of Google reviews posted since the start of 2023 to find out which national parks are the most aesthetically pleasing. The Travel Lens team looked at the total number of reviews, as well as the number of reviews containing the words "beautiful," "stunning," breathtaking" and "gorgeous."

Crater Lake National Park in Oregon was deemed the most beautiful park in America, claiming 45.26% of reviews praising its natural beauty.

"The lake is so so blue, as blue as the deep sea, and it’s just a lake!" wrote one Google user last month. "Amazing experience, dazzling views, stunning nature."

See below for the ranking of the 25 national parks to top Travel Lens' list. A few major national parks did not make the list.

Ranked: The top 25 most beautiful national parks

Crater Lake National Park's main claim to fame is that it houses the deepest lake in the country (1,943 feet) - a body of water so deep and so blue that it attracts half a million visitors per year.

At four, Utah has the most national parks to make the list, followed by Colorado, Arizona and Washington, which each had two. Some major national parks did not make the list, including Grand Canyon, Yosemite and Yellowstone national parks.

  1. Crater Lake National Park, Oregon
  2. Acadia National Park, Maine
  3. Glacier National Park, Montana
  4. Shenandoah National Park, Virginia
  5. Great Smoky Mountains National Park, Tennessee and North Carolina
  6. New River Gorge National Park Preserve, West Virginia
  7. Grand Teton National Park, Wyoming
  8. Mount Rainier National Park, Washington
  9. Glacier Bay National Park and Preserve, Alaska
  10. Black Canyon of the Gunnison National Park, Colorado
  11. Capitol Reef National Park, Utah
  12. Rocky Mountain National Park, Colorado
  13. Saguaro National Park, Arizona
  14. Olympic National Park, Washington
  15. Theodore Roosevelt National Park, North Dakota
  16. Cuyahoga Valley National Park, Ohio
  17. Haleakalã National Park, Hawaii
  18. Big Bend National Park, Texas
  19. Zion National Park, Utah
  20. Badlands National Park, South Dakota
  21. Canyonlands National Park, Utah
  22. Redwood National and State Parks, California
  23. White Sands National Park, New Mexico
  24. Arches National Park, Utah
  25. Petrified Forest National Park, Arizona
